Online Class Availability at University of Maine at Farmington

Online coursework is an option at University of Maine at Farmington. Among 2,100 students, 610 (29%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 340 (16%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Rehabilitation Professions Graduates from University of Maine at Farmington

Students who complete University of Maine at Farmington’s Rehabilitation Professions program earn at the following median levels (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):

Median earnings by years after graduation for Rehabilitation Professions at University of Maine at Farmington
Years After Graduation Median Earnings
1 year $33,770
2 years $30,047
5 years $39,979
